More about the Odds to Probability Calculator so that you can better understand the elements used in this calculator. It is common for people to confuse odds and probability, and often times, they incorrectly used, especially when talking about odds.

The odds for the occurrence of an event are simply the probability of occurrence of an event, divided by the probability that the event does not occur. Or for example, if there are 8 equally likely individual outcomes, and 6 of them favor of an event, and 2 are against the event, then the odds for the occurrence of the event are "6 to 2", or "6/2" or simply 3. So, the odds can be any positive number, it does not have to be a number between 0 and 1.

The expression that is used to compute the probability of an event, \(p\), given the odds is shown below:

\[ p = \displaystyle \frac{Odds}{1 + Odds}\]

The conversion from odds to probability is usually referred also as a odds to risk conversion.
